Ferrets Weasels and Badgers

These mammals are flesh-eaters of the family Mustelidae. Usually named as weasel family, these are typically small-sized animals with short legs, thick furs and round ears. Mustelids are mostly nocturnal, solitary and are active throughout a year.

Is the honey badger related to the skunk?

Skunks belong to a different family than honey badgers. They both belong to the same superfamily, though, which is Musteloidea. So they are not super closely related, but they are somewhat related.

Ferrets are induced ovulators and if the Jill's are not mated then bone marrow depression can lead to a non regenerative anemia?

If a Jill ferret is not mated a build up of estrogen may lead to a disorder know as estrogen-induced anemia, which can lead to leukemia and ultimate death

What prey do weasels have?

Weasels are predators and are surprisingly very aggressive and will attack almost any animal on sight. Otters are members of the weasel family and eat fish primarily. Weasels eat many vermin such as moles, shrews, and rats.

Is a wolverine a bear?

No, it is a member of the weasel family.

How do ferrets hunt do they hunt alone or in packs?

Ferrets are solitary animals and hunt alone. Ferrets kill their prey with a sharp bite to the back of the neck.

How smart a mink is?

Mink Intelligence

Like their cousins, the otters, mink are very playful. They are very inquisitive, highly intelligent animals. A study was performed that compared the learning ability of mink to ferrets, skunks, and house cats. The animals were tested on their ability to remember different shapes. The order of ability of remembering these different shapes were from best to worst; mink, ferrets, skunks and cats. Mink were in fact found to be more intelligent than certain groups of primates. After considerable training, mink were also found to learn after only one trial. This is a phenomenon usually only observed in higher primates Source: wikipedia
